Bradwell Bury is a moated site and associated manor house remains located at Moat House in Bradwell, Buckinghamshire. The monument comprises the earthwork remains of a medieval moat and platform, which once enclosed and defended a residential structure, typical of high-status settlement in the medieval period. The site represents the physical remains of a manorial holding, reflecting the settlement hierarchy and land organisation of medieval Buckinghamshire. The moat and its associated features survive as earthwork evidence, preserving important archaeological and historical information about domestic and social arrangements within the medieval landscape.

Bradwell Bury: a moated site and associated manor house remains at Moat House is a scheduled monument protected by Historic England under reference 1011298. View the official record →
